Has anyone found a feasible solution on globally updating their Android devices without impacting the bandwidth at the various locations the devices are located at?
Android OS management is a problem that I don't think will be going away any time soon. My end customers tried to avoid taxing the bandwidth at the local sites for a long time, trying creative alternatives like local FTP relay servers or offline updates to the devices. Many however have eventually given in now and have upgraded the ISP connections in their remote sites in order to be able to handle the increase in bandwidth requirements.

For devices with firmware images downloable from OEM vendors such as Zebra, one possible direction maybe is to explore feasibility of using Soti XtremeHub. You can have hubs/servers at different countries/regions/cities/sites levels, in which big device OS image files can be cached locally using a Hub-node (a device itself being managed by MobiControl) before being transferred to other targeted devices using free corporate Wifi/wireline network locally in the same site. Post-script of associated MobiControl File-sync rule/policy can subsequently be used to automatically initiate the actual update of the transferred OS flash image file.
For OEM brand devices that gets OS image file directly from the OEM backend server, there seems to be no other bandwidth efficient option at the moment.
